IOOF - Babys Hurst, baby graves 1 NE Lot #300, died Salem.
NOTE - Both IOOF, and Terwilliger indicate that this is one of a pair of twins who died within a few days of each other.
DEATH CERTIFICATE: 
OSBH DC (Marion Co., 1911) #1785 - Infant Hurst, born 3 Jun 1911 in Oregon, died 4 Jun 1911 in Salem Oregon (727 Union St.) at age 1 day (premature) name of father is Russel Hurst (b. Illinois) maiden name of mother Lilia Hedlind (b. Iowa), interment 6 Jun 1911, undertaker Terwilliger, informant Russell Hurst of Salem.
OBITUARY: 
Born to Die - Saturday at noon there were born to Mr. and Mrs. Russell Hurst, at their home, 727 Union street, twins. They came to be but gathered back into the arms of Him who said, "Suffer little children to come unto me, and forbid them not, for such is the kingdom of heaven." One died Sunday evening and was buried Wednesday, and the other died at 3:30 this morning, Funeral notice later.
Daily Capital Journal 8 Jun 1911, 6:4
